c++ interop in executables

I want to work on making a small qt interop binding with Mojo which will require c++ interop. My question is: when I compile my binary executable, will the necessary c++ files get compiled and added to the binary as well (so it can be distributed)? Can I static linking them and add them to the executable? What will distribution look like for mojo files?

The Mojo compiler driver currently does not support linking in any other native code. There is nothing fundamental blocking this, and this is likely to change in the future, but for now, this is not possible.
